Direct formation of β-glycosides of N-acetyl glycosamines mediated by rare earth metal triflates
Christensen, Helle,Christiansen, Mira Steinicke,Petersen, Jette,Jensen, Henrik Helligso
experimental part, p. 3276 - 3283 (2009/02/05)
A direct, mild and efficient protocol for the preparation of β-glycosides of N-acetyl glucosamine (GlcNAc) and N-acetyl galactosamine (GalNAc) has been developed using peracetylated β-GlcNAc and β-GalNAc as donors. All rare Earth metal triflate promoters
